Platinum DJ and Producer HUGEL returns to Defected Records alongside tech house rising star DERON for their new single “Coge El Paso” featuring La Payara. The song is two minutes and 28 seconds of pure dance vibes and good times. It is sure to make almost anyone bop their heads or even do a little dance while listening.

The Latin DJ and producer is a multi-gold and platinum-selling artist with over one billion streams to his name, as well as many of his tracks reaching the number one spot on Beatport. His music is played in top venues and most credible events all over the world.

Before that though, the Latin artist grew up in Marseille by the Mediterranean Sea (South of France). His mother raised him with funk, disco, and soul music being the norm in his life. He discovered the art of DJing with vinyl at 16 years of age, influenced by the style of Carl Cox, Laurent Garnier, Daft punk, Amine Edge, and David Guetta. After a few years of learning production, HUGEL became a hitmaker. His house music is inspired by Ibiza (Spain) and the Latin culture he soaked up while siding on the island. This led to the global asrtist selling out shows in Miami, NYC, and Los Angeles. He had residencies at Pacha & Ushuaia in Ibiza and has played the biggest festivals in the world, such as EDC Las Vegas, EDC Mexico, Tomorrowland, Lollapalooza, Parookaville, World Club Dome, Mysteryland.
